Introduced as the company's first venture into the manufacturing of multi-layer ceramic capacitors (MLCCs) in chip form, these new surface-mount caps include both Class 1 NPO and Class 2 X7R devices and Y5V low- and high-voltage devices. Targeting high-frequency telecommunication, automotive, consumer and data processing applications, the MLCCs are said to deliver high capacitance per unit volume. Voltage ratings range from 10V for the low-voltage components up to 3 kV for the high-voltage models. The capacitors are available either on tape-and-reel or in plastic bags with delivery times running from three to six weeks. Data sheets and design-in support are available.
